The American school system may be different from what you have there.
We start with Kindergarten, then have 1st through 5th or 6th grades which are known as elementary school. 6th or 7th through 8th are Middle School (It used to be Jr. High.) High school starts at
9th grade, which is Freshman year, 10th grade, which is Sophomore year, 11th grade, which is Junion year, and then 12th grade, which is Senior year. At that point one graduates and goes to college.
